
Kolkata, Sept. 4 -- The West Bengal Joint Entrance Examinations Board (WBJEEB) has revised the schedule for decentralised e-counselling for admission to vacant seats in undergraduate engineering, technology, architecture and pharmacy courses. The two-phase process will be held from September 6 to 25.
The vacant-seat matrix for the first phase will be published at 7 pm on September 6. Registration, fee payment, profile creation and choice selection will be open from 10 am on September 7 to 11.59 pm on September 8.
The Round 1 merit and allocation list will be published at 10 am on September 10. Candidates allotted seats will have to pay the seat-acceptance fee and obtain a provisional admission receipt by September 11. Physical document verification and admission or withdrawal confirmation will be conducted at the respective institutions from September 10 to 12.
The Round 2 new allocation list will be published on September 13. Candidates will have to complete fee payment and physical verification within the stipulated deadlines. Those withdrawing a seat will also have to confirm the cancellation on the portal.
The second phase will begin with publication of the vacant-seat matrix at 5 pm on September 16. Registration and choice selection will continue till September 18. The Round 1 allocation list will be published on September 20, followed by the Round 2 new allocation list on September 23.
